Output 585c56076d4fd5823f3c96baf14fbaafcd7606c00c3e7c5fa47ff6a4b760793f:1

value
28973289
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5138a26e07e39fcc563a3a137f5d29ec11ccbee2 OP_EQUALVERIFY OP_CHECKSIG
address
18QTaaAFRK1X28WHwS7AEVdFDJ95zfyUdp
transaction
585c56076d4fd5823f3c96baf14fbaafcd7606c00c3e7c5fa47ff6a4b760793f
spent
true